Message d'erreur lors de la création d'un sous domaine en utilisant l'api de ples
... / Message d'erreur lors de ...
BMPCreated with Sketch.BMPZIPCreated with Sketch.ZIPXLSCreated with Sketch.XLSTXTCreated with Sketch.TXTPPTCreated with Sketch.PPTPNGCreated with Sketch.PNGPDFCreated with Sketch.PDFJPGCreated with Sketch.JPGGIFCreated with Sketch.GIFDOCCreated with Sketch.DOC Error Created with Sketch.
question

Message d'erreur lors de la création d'un sous domaine en utilisant l'api de ples

Par
GhislainN1
Créé le 2021-02-05 00:56:13 (edited on 2024-09-04 13:30:10) dans Domaines

Salut à tous,
Merci pour cette plateforme d'échange.

J'ai ce message qui s'affiche lorsque j'essaie de créer un sous domaine à partir de mon code php.

**`POST https://eu.api.ovh.com/1.0/domain/zone/mondomain.com/record` resulted in a `400 Bad Request` response: {"message":"Invalid signature","httpCode":"400 Bad Request","errorCode":"INVALID_SIGNATURE"}**

J'utilise l'api OVH pour php .
J'ai généré les clés AK, AS, et CK en utilisant la doc ovh.

Voici à quoi ressemble le bout de code pour la création du sousdomaine en question

$ovh = new Api( $applicationKey, // Application Key
$applicationSecret, // Application Secret
'ovh-eu', // Endpoint of API OVH Europe (List of available endpoints)
$consumerKey); // Consumer Key

$result = $ovh->post('/domain/zone/mondomain.com/record', array(
'fieldType' => 'A', // Resource record Name (type: zone.NamedResolutionFieldTypeEnum)
'subDomain' => 'test-sousdomain', // Resource record subdomain (type: string)
'target' => 'monIP', // Resource record target (type: string) ssh root@
'ttl' => '0', // Resource record ttl (type: long)
));

Merci pour l'attension que vous porterez à ce sujet.


Les réponses sont actuellement désactivées pour cette question.